Agricultural water withdrawals vs. GDP per capita in Tajikistan
Tajikistan: Agricultural water withdrawals vs. GDP per capita was 74.5% in 2022. ▼ Falling
Agricultural water withdrawals vs. GDP per capita in Tajikistan, 1994–2022
Source: AQUASTAT - FAO's Global Information System on Water and Agriculture, FAO, via World Bank (2026) – processed by Our World in Data. Measured in % of total freshwater withdrawal.
Analysis
Tajikistan recorded 74.5% for agricultural water withdrawals vs. gdp per capita in 2022.
Compared with earlier readings it is down 18.2% over ten years.
Over the whole period, agricultural water withdrawals vs. gdp per capita in Tajikistan peaked at 92.9% in 1999 and was at its lowest, 64.9%, in 2017.
That places Tajikistan 62nd out of 180 countries with data for 2022, putting it in the middle of the range.
The long-run direction has been consistently falling across the 29 years of available data.

About this data
Share of total water withdrawals used in agriculture versus gross domestic product (GDP) per capita, adjusted for inflation and differences in living costs between countries.
